> I have an Access report that includes sorting an grouping. The first
> sort is by Section, then by a ReportNo, but I also a a printorder
> field. I need to have my report print by Section, then ReportNo and
> then within the ReportNo, it needs to sort ascending by Printorder.
> The report is developed from a query. If I change my sorting order to
> Section, PrintOrder, then ReportNo then I lose the proper grouping for
> ReportNo.
